  • Mack Brown Adds NFL Experience And Talent To UNC's Coaching Staff With Kitchens Hire

    The University of North Carolina has named long-time NFL coach Freddie Kitchens its new run game coordinator and tight ends coach, Head Coach Mack Brown announced on Tuesday. A 24-year coaching veteran, Kitchens spent last season as a Senior Football Analyst at South Carolina following a 16-year run in the NFL that included a stint as the Cleveland Browns head coach and a trip to the Super Bowl with the Arizona Cardinals.

  • CJ Kayfus Steps Up And Delivers A Walk-Off Two Run Homer For The Miami Hurricanes

    Miami Hurricanes first baseman CJ Kayfus was frustrated.

    The 2022 Hurricanes MVP picked up just one hit across his first 10 at-bats in 2023.

    But after a pep-talk from junior catcher Jack Scanlon, Kayfus quickly became the Hurricanes’ hero Sunday afternoon.

    Kayfus delivered a walk-off two-run homer in the bottom of the ninth inning, lifting No. 22 Miami to a 3-2 win over Penn State at Alex Rodriguez Park at Mark Light Field.
